Verdict

Possibly not as competitive as Division 1 thirty minutes earlier, so we'll take a chance on one of the newcomers with the Archie Watson-trained EXECLUSIVE fitting the profile of a probable winner. A 40,000gns yearling who is a half-sister to four winners and also closely related to a couple of useful winners in Italy and France, she's preferred to the Paul and Clare Rooney-owned Spanish Time who on pedigree is likely to need considerably further than this 5f trip.
